主页C++ Builder 资料C++ Builder 参考手册其他数据类型TMouseActivate
C++ Builder 串口控件
C++ Builder 编程技巧
C++ Builder 操作指南
C++ Builder 参考手册
基础知识
cfloat 浮点数
cmath 数学函数
cstdlib 标准库函数
System 字符串
System 日期和时间
System.Math.hpp 数学函数
其他数据类型
 • TAlign
 • TAnchors
 • TCaption
 • TComponentState
 • TComponentStyle
 • TControlState
 • TControlStyle
 • TCursor
 • TDockOrientation
 • TDragKind
 • TDragMode
 • TDragState
 • TMouseActivate
 • TMouseButton
 • TScalingFlags
 • TShiftState
 • TStyleElements
VCL 基础类
VCL 应用程序
Pictures 图片
Graphics 绘图
Additional 控件
System 控件
A ~ Z 字母顺序排列的目录
网友留言/技术支持
TMouseActivate - 鼠标点击激活窗口

TMouseActivate: 鼠标点击激活窗口

请参考:TControlOnMouseActivate 事件和 MouseActivate 方法。

 

头文件:

#include <System.UITypes.hpp> (XE2 之后),#include <UITypes.hpp> (XE 之前)

 

命名空间:

System::Uitypes

 

TMouseActivate 成员

TMouseActivate 是枚举类型,定义如下:

enum class TMouseActivate : unsigned char { maDefault, maActivate, maActivateAndEat, maNoActivate, maNoActivateAndEat };

可以使用的值如下:

激活窗口 说明
maDefault 让 Parent 处理 OnMouseActivate 事件
maActivate 激活 Form (提到最前) 并且把鼠标点击事件传递给这个 Form,不转给 Parent 处理
maActivateAndEat 激活 Form (提到最前) 并且把鼠标点击事件扔掉
maNoActivate 不激活 Form 并且把鼠标点击事件传递给这个 Form
maNoActivateAndEat 不激活 Form 并且把鼠标点击事件扔掉
◤上一页:TDragState下一页:TMouseButton

C++ 爱好者 -- Victor Chen 的个人网站 www.cppfans.com 辽ICP备11016859号